NATIONAL TEST
On Monday 27 July 2026, a Critical Alert Test will be sent to all compatible mobile devices in Australia. The alert will override 'silent' and 'do not disturb' device settings. It will appear like a system notification on screens and make a loud siren sound for 10 seconds..
AUSTRALIAN LAUNCH
The Australian Government official AusAlert website says: On 1 October 2026, AusAlert will become a vital part of Australia’s emergency warning systems. AusAlert lets the Australian Government and emergency services organisations send alerts to compatible mobile devices. It’s just one of the many ways we’re helping to keep Australians safer during local and national emergencies and disasters.
To receive an AusAlert during a disaster or emergency, you don't need to register or download an app. Everybody near the area affected by the emergency will receive an alert if they have a compatible mobile device. This includes visitors to the area and people using roaming on their device. AusAlert will eventually replace the existing SMS-based alert system, which is called Emergency Alert.
AUSALERT ✚ GRAPHENE OS
Graphene OS provides option for its users to adjust many settings that typical mobile phone OS (Operating systems) do not provide. These AusAlert alerts (also called Wireless Emergency Alerts) can be turned off in Settings / Safety & Emergency / Wireless Emergency Alerts and turning the toggle switch to the off position, or selecting other options you may wish to use.
